Crimson Big Favorite In Dinghy Race Today

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

Crimson sailers are a heavy favorite as they square off against seven other top Ivy League crews in the first race of the new Ivy League Dinghy Championship this afternoon.

The first race is scheduled to start at 1 p. m. at the M. I. T. sailing pavilion on the Charles River Basin; port time for skippers and crews today is 13:30 p.m. Tomorrow's racing series will start at 10 a.m.

Carter Ford, captain of the Crimson sailing team, will start as skipper in the "A" division for Harvard. Mike Horn will start in the "B" division, while Mike Lehmann is available for relief.

Bus Mosbacher, skipper of the victorious American's Cup defender, Weatherly, has donated the perpetual trophy for the new championship.
